Introduction
Dead Effect 2 is nowhere near as hard as Dead Effect 1. In Dead Effect 1 you need to correct weapons to beat the game. In Dead Effect 2 it is much easier and doesn’t require certain weapons to beat the game. You can’t play Dead Effect 2 like a modern military shooters. You have to play Dead Effect 2 like the old FPS games ie, Quake and Doom which I will explain later.
Skills
It pretty easy to figure out which skills are the best. In general all passive abilities should be taken.

Any game that give Slow Motion skill is abusive and should upgrade to the max if allow.

The best skill in the game by far for every class is Bullet Time. Upgrade it to the max.

For Class Abilities Storm is the best skill for the Gunner Class. Storm give you a renewable grenade. Upgrade it to the Max.

All the skills in the Weapon and General Ability should be taken because they are all passive.

Ammo Carry should be max out.

Pyroman Should be max out.

Class ability cooldown should be max out.

Special ability cooldown should be max out.

Explorer should be max out.


Gears
Armor and implants that give energy, energy regeneration, and health should taken over others. Health being the most important of the three. Try to buy the latest armor if possible. Implants are less important but still good to keep them uptodate.
Weapons
All the weapons are good enough for you to beat the game with. I went with Shotgun and Assault Rifle as primary. Pistol and Revolver as Secondary.

In the early game I alternated between Assault Rifle and Shotgun. In the middle I went with the total upgrade Assault Rifle provided to me in mission 11 Teleported Cyborg. It is good enough for the mid game levels. Late levels I bought the Mythic Hydra 2CL shotgun and upgrade to max damage and magazine size. At max damage the Hydra could do over 40k damage making the end boss fight pretty easy.

Don’t discount the Teslabolt. While I didn’t upgrade it it is useful in boss or hard fights. The default damage is very good.
Tactics
You can’t play Dead Effect like a modern shooter. Cover and shooting doesn’t work because the enemies that shoot back have very good accuracy. Only use cover to reload your weapons.

You have to play it like the old school FPS games. Against enemies that shoot back you have to strafe them. If you don’t know what strafing is I posted a link to wikipedia below for you to read.

The best solution to fighting soldiers and bosses is hit bullet time, get into point blank range, and strafe the target (headshots for extra damage). Repeat until all is dead. For fighting soldiers bullet time is not require but use it if you have it. In boss fight bullet time is needed to migrate the damage. It took me 6 bullet time cycle to beat the last boss in the game. Two of bullet times cycle were wasted because he put his shield up.
General Tips
Buy a lot health packs. Keep at least 10 on hand.

Buy ammo packs.

Use Storm and Grenades against large groups and boss fights.

Use covers to reload weapons.

Upgrade Weapons damage and magazine size first.

Get Headshot if possible.

If zombies push you back into a corner, you can sprint pass zombies to a better location.

Zombies are slows so mobility is the key.

Always keep your health up in boss fights. A series of AOE hits can kill you instantly if not at full or near full health.

When your bullet time is on cooldown while fighting a boss. Hide behind some cover. Reload your weapons. Once bullet time is up again go on the offensive.

Use Teslabolt at the beginning of the attack or when you empty your primary weapon fighting a boss. The extra damage does help.

Use Sprint to close the distance when using bullet time.

Sell unused gears and weapons.
